Description

Position Summary

Assistant Coaches are responsible for coaching and recruiting students for assigned athletic event.  Behaves and conducts work processes in a manner consistent with the Northwest Athletic Conference (NWAC) coaching standards and the College’s guiding principles. Performs all functions and activities within the guidelines and philosophy set forth in the BMCC Mission, Vision and Strategic Plan.

Essential Functions

Under the direction of the Head Coach:

  • From direction of head coach, provides quality coaching and instruction to students participating in the Baseball program; develops, implements, and teaches related training session and techniques.
  • Recruit student athletes in accordance with NWAC athletic regulations, conference and college values, and commitment to student success.
  • Assist in supervising student athletes on trips and onsite during all program related practices, games, and functions.
  • Work cooperatively with head coach to maintain and retain records on students, including, but not limited to, athletic eligibility budgets, recruitment, and transportation.
  • Serve as role model to assist the team members in developing and displaying appropriate attitudes and behavior expected of athletic teams and individuals representing BMCC.
  • Assist head coach in providing post-season evaluation of all players.
  • Assist head coach in team-sponsored fund-raising throughout the year as approved by the Director of Athletics.
  • Behaves in a manner that is consistent with the NWAC codebook, including but not limited to: NWAC coach’s code of conduct, coach’s standards and procedures, job responsibilities, and Concussion Management.  Includes passing NWAC required tests.
  • Follow all BMCC guidelines, administrative procedures, and policies surrounding athletics and specific to BMCC Athletic Trainer.
  • Promote BMCC athletic programs in our community college district.
  • Maintains sensitivity, understanding, and respect for a diverse academic environment, inclusive of students, faculty, and staff of varying social, ability, economic, cultural, ideological, and ethnic backgrounds.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Other Aspects of the Position

  • Must be available for recruiting, practices and games during weekday afternoons, evenings and weekends as needed.
  • Must be familiar with the BMCC Student Athlete Code of Conduct.
  • Travel to games and athletic events as needed, valid driver’s license required.

Qualifications


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

Individuals must possess the following knowledge, skills, and abilities or be able to explain and demonstrate that the individual can perform the essential functions of the job, with or without reasonable accommodation, using some other combination of skills and abilities:

  • Ability to coach students effectively and to evaluate their performance in the assigned activity.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ills are required.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with students, staff, professional colleagues from other colleges and the public.
  • Requires personal attributes necessary to motivate students, guide the development of appropriate behaviors and values, plus must be able to facilitate the development of technical performance skills.
  • Must be sensitive to and understand the diverse socioeconomic, academic, cultural and ethnic backgrounds of community college students.
  • Ability to work closely with students to achieve their educational goals.
  • Knowledge of principles of athletic conditioning, including weight training and athletic training desired.

Preferred Education and Experience

  • Associate degree.
  • Previous successful coaching experience.
  • Current First Aid/CPR certification. (Can be obtained once hired)

Part Time:

This is a part time position up to 20 hours per week as needed; 10 months per year (September - June).  Part time employees earn 1 hour of sick leave for every 30 hours worked.

Pay:  $491.10 per month
